Family Medicine Doctors In Midfield, AL
MD
Midfield, AL with 21+ years experience
MD
Fairfield, AL with 1-2 years experience
MD
Fairfield, AL with 6-10 years experience
MD
Fairfield, AL with 21+ years experience
MD
Hueytown, AL with 6-10 years experience
(205) 744-4410
2800 Allison Bonnett Memorial Dr
Hueytown, AL 35023
2.62 miles away
MD
Hueytown, AL with 21+ years experience
(205) 744-4410
2800 Allison Bonnett Memorial Dr
Hueytown, AL 35023
3.09 miles away
MD
Hueytown, AL with 21+ years experience
(205) 744-4410
2800 Allison Bonnett Memorial Dr
Hueytown, AL 35023
3.09 miles away
MD
Birmingham, AL with 11-20 years experience
MD
Hueytown, AL with 21+ years experience
(205) 491-3299
3004 Allison Bonnett Memorial Dr
Hueytown, AL 35023
3.31 miles away
DO
Hueytown, AL with 21+ years experience
(205) 491-3299
3004 Allison Bonnett Memorial Dr
Hueytown, AL 35023
3.31 miles away
MD
Birmingham, AL with 21+ years experience
MD
Bessemer, AL with 21+ years experience
MD
Bessemer, AL with 21+ years experience
MD
Bessemer,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 3-5 years experience
U of AL Sch of Med
Birmingham, AL 35201
4.71 miles away
MD
Birmingham, AL with 3-5 years experience
(205) 679-6325
1308 Tuscaloosa Avenue SW
Birmingham, AL 35211
4.71 miles away
MD
Birmingham, AL with 21+ years experience
MD
Shannon, AL with 21+ years experience
P.O. Box 111
Shannon, AL 35142
4.75 miles away
MD
Birmingham, AL with 21+ years experience
(205) 290-0088
2757 Greensprings Hwy
Birmingham, AL 35209
4.82 miles away
DO
Birmingham, AL with 6-10 years experience
MD
Birmingham, AL with 21+ years experience
Family Medicine
- General Family Medicine
- Sports Medicine (Non-Surgical)
(205) 264-2816
801 Princeton ave s.w. Pob1
Birmingham, AL 35211
5.25 miles away
MD
Birmingham, AL with 21+ years experience
(205) 206-8461
832 Princeton Ave Sw
Birmingham, AL 35211
5.3 miles away
MD
Birmingham, AL with 21+ years experience
MD
Homewood, AL with 11-20 years experience
MD
Birmingham, AL with 21+ years experience
(205) 930-2950
1 W Lakeshore Dr Ste 100
Birmingham, AL 35209
6.14 miles away
MD
Birmingham, AL with 21+ years experience
(205) 930-2950
1 W Lakeshore Dr Ste 100
Birmingham, AL 35209
6.14 miles away
MD
Birmingham, AL with 21+ years experience
(205) 930-2950
1 W Lakeshore Dr Ste 100
Birmingham, AL 35209
6.14 miles away
DO
Birmingham, AL with 21+ years experience
(205) 290-0088
2757 Green Springs Hwy
Birmingham, AL 35209
6.27 miles away
MD
Birmingham, AL with 21+ years experience
(205) 877-2589
2018 Brookwood Medical Ctr Dr
Birmingham, AL 35209
6.62 miles away
MD
Birmingham, AL with 1-2 years experience
MD
Birmingham, AL with 6-10 years experience
MD
Birmingham, AL with 21+ years experience
MD
Hoover, AL with 21+ years experience
DO
Bessemer,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
Family Medicine
- Complementary and Integrative Medicine
- Emergency Medicine
MD
Birmingham, AL with 21+ years experience
(205) 595-5504
Seale Harris Clinic
Birmingham, AL 35205
7.08 miles away
MD
Hoover,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
(205) 397-1016
200 Montgomery Hwy # 31
Birmingham, AL 35216
7.29 miles away
MD
Bessemer, AL with 6-10 years experience
MD
Birmingham, AL with 6-10 years experience
Family Medicine
- General Family Medicine
- Hospice & Palliative Medicine
CH19, Suite 219
Birmingham, AL 35294
7.45 miles away
DO
Birmingham,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Hospice & Palliative Medicine
MD
Birmingham, AL with 1-2 years experience
DO
Birmingham, AL with 6-10 years experience
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 6-10 years experience
(256) 551-4631
625 19th Street South
Birmingham, AL 35249
7.72 miles away
MD
Birmingham, AL with 1-2 years experience
700 South 19th St
Birmingham, AL 35233
7.74 miles away
MD
Birmingham, AL with 1-2 years experience
(205) 934-3108
Uab Department Of Radiology
Birmingham, AL 35249
7.76 miles away
MD
Birmingham, AL with 21+ years experience
3081 Lorna Rd Ste 101
Birmingham, AL 352164509
7.77 miles away
MD
Birmingham, AL with 21+ years experience
Family Medicine
- General Family Medicine
- Hospice & Palliative Medicine
(205) 934-6600
619 19th Street South
Birmingham, AL 35233
7.77 miles away
MD
Birmingham, AL with 21+ years experience
Family Medicine
- General Family Medicine
- Hospice & Palliative Medicine
(205) 934-6600
619 19th Street South
Birmingham, AL 35255
7.78 miles away
MD
Birmingham, AL with 1-2 years experience
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
(205) 877-8585
3401 Independence Dr
Birmingham, AL 35209
7.82 miles away
MD
Birmingham, AL with 6-10 years experience
MD
Birmingham,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Geriatric Medicine
- Women's Health
MD
Birmingham,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Hospital Medicine/Hospitalist
(507) 292-7070
930 20th Street South
Birmingham, AL 35205
7.87 miles away
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Sports Medicine (Non-Surgical)
(352) 392-1161
2000 6th Avenue South
Birmingham, AL 35233
7.93 miles away
MD
Hoover, AL with 21+ years experience
Family Medicine
- General Family Medicine
- Sports Medicine (Non-Surgical)
DO
Birmingham, AL with 6-10 years experience
MD
Birmingham, AL with 21+ years experience
(205) 212-5600
1600 20th St South
Birmingham, AL 35205
7.98 miles away
MD
Birmingham, AL with 6-10 years experience
(706) 296-3375
1680 Montgomery Hwy
Birmingham, AL 35216
7.99 miles away
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
(205) 979-0888
1680 Montgomery Hwy
Birmingham, AL 35216
8.02 miles away
MD
Birmingham, AL with 21+ years experience
(205) 791-2273
1664 forestdale blvd
Birmingham, AL 35244
8.03 miles away
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
(205) 877-8677
2151 Highland Ave S
Birmingham, AL 35205
8.13 miles away
MD
Hoover, AL with 21+ years experience
MD
Hoover, AL with 3-5 years experience
MD
Hoover, AL with 11-20 years experience
MD
Bessemer, AL with 21+ years experience
MD
Hoover,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Urgent Care
(205) 987-6801
2503 John Hawkins Parkway
Hoover, AL 35244
8.19 miles away
MD
Birmingham, AL with 21+ years experience
MD
Bessemer, AL with 11-20 years experience
MD
Hoover, AL with 21+ years experience
MD
Birmingham, AL with 11-20 years experience
(205) 733-6676
3421 S Shades Crest Rd
Birmingham, AL 35244
8.26 miles away
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
MD
Birmingham, AL with 21+ years experience
DO
Hoover, AL with 6-10 years experience
MD
Birmingham, AL with 3-5 years experience
U of AL Sch of Med
Birmingham, AL 35201
8.35 miles away
MD
Birmingham, AL with 1-2 years experience
Family Medicine
- General Resident Physician
U of AL Sch of Med
Birmingham, AL 35201
8.35 miles away
MD
Birmingham, AL with 1-2 years experience
U of AL Sch of Med
Birmingham, AL 35201
8.35 miles away
MD
Hoover, AL with 21+ years experience
Family Medicine
- Adolescent Medicine
- General Family Medicine
MD
Birmingham, AL with 11-20 years experience
Family Medicine
- General Family Medicine
- Hospital Medicine/Hospitalist
(205) 877-2707
2006 Brookwood Medical Center Dr
Birmingham, AL 35209
8.39 miles away
MD
Birmingham, AL with 11-20 years experience
(205) 930-2456
810 Saint Vincents Dr
Birmingham, AL 35205
8.49 miles away
MD
Birmingham, AL with 11-20 years experience
(205) 930-2456
2660 10th Avenue South
Birmingham, AL 35205
8.49 miles away
DO
Birmingham, AL with 6-10 years experience
Family Medicine
- General Family Medicine
- Hospital Medicine/Hospitalist
MD
Hoover, AL with 11-20 years experience
(205) 988-8311
5346 Stadium Trace Pkwy
Hoover, AL 35244
8.5 miles away
MD
Birmingham, AL with 6-10 years experience
Family Medicine
- General Family Medicine
- Sports Medicine (Non-Surgical)
(205) 595-5504
805 Saint Vincents Dr
Birmingham, AL 35205
8.56 miles away
MD
Birmingham, AL with 6-10 years experience
(205) 595-5504
805 Saint Vincents Dr
Birmingham, AL 35205
8.56 miles away
MD
Birmingham, AL with 3-5 years experience
(205) 939-3699
805 Saint Vincents Dr
Birmingham, AL 35205
8.56 miles away
MD
Birmingham, AL with 21+ years experience
(205) 250-8100
2018 Brookwood Medical Ctr Dr
Birmingham, AL 35209
8.57 miles away
MD
Birmingham, AL with 21+ years experience
(205) 930-2346
810 Saint Vincents Dr
Birmingham, AL 35205
8.58 miles away
DO
Birmingham, AL with 11-20 years experience
(205) 595-5504
805 St. Vincent's Dr.
Birmingham, AL 35205
8.58 miles away
MD
Birmingham, AL with 1-2 years experience
MD
Birmingham, AL with 21+ years experience
DO
Birmingham, AL with 21+ years experience